J.S. asks from Carver, MA on March 03, 2009
Need Party Place - 6 Yr Old Party
I really need a fun, inexpensive place to have my son's 6th birthday party at. We usually have family cookouts but this year he wants to have all his kindergarten friends at his party. I have heard of a place that has a bunch of "jumpy" things but that is too far away. Anything like that in the south shore? Any other ideas?

B.J. answers from Boston on March 04, 2009
Creative Playthings in Pembroke has a room that has a jumpy thing, climbing structures, trampoline. You can rent it for birthday parties. They include pizza, cake, good bags for $250.

C.W. answers from Boston on March 04, 2009
I've done Boomerangs and Plaster Funtime with my kids in the past. Recently though, my 6 year old went to a "basketball party" where they used the gym in the church hall. They brought cupcakes and one table to put presents on, and the kids played basketball and dodge ball the entire time. The kids had a blast and I'm sure the mom didn't spend a lot of money.
